About Yoonsup Kim

Yoonsup Kim is a scholar working on Geophysics, Artificial Intelligence, Paleontology, Geochemistry and Petrology and Geology, having authored 25 papers that have together received 335 indexed citations. Recurring topics across this work include Geological and Geochemical Analysis (21 papers), Geochemistry and Geologic Mapping (17 papers), Paleontology and Stratigraphy of Fossils (8 papers), High-pressure geophysics and materials (6 papers), Geology and Paleoclimatology Research (3 papers), Geological and Geophysical Studies (2 papers), earthquake and tectonic studies (2 papers) and Geochemistry and Elemental Analysis (2 papers). The work is most often cited by research in Geophysics (310 citations), Paleontology (56 citations), Geochemistry and Petrology (36 citations), Geology (31 citations) and Artificial Intelligence (170 citations). Yoonsup Kim has collaborated with scholars based in South Korea, Vietnam and Italy. Frequent co-authors include Moonsup Cho, Jinho Ahn, Keewook Yi, Yuyoung Lee, Seung Ryeol Lee, Jong Ik Lee, Chang‐Sik Cheong, E. Ernst, Ian S. Williams and Namhoon Kim. Their work appears in journals such as Geosciences Journal, Geological Journal, Geological Society of America Bulletin, International Geology Review and Terra Nova.
